Specifications
Polarization: Polar
Package / Case: Radial, Can
Mounting Type: Through Hole
Surface Mount Land Size: --
Height - Seated (Max): 0.551" (14.00mm)
Size / Dimension: 0.492" Dia (12.50mm)
Lead Spacing: 0.197" (5.00mm)
Ripple Current @ High Frequency: 828mA @ 10kHz
Ripple Current @ Low Frequency: 720mA @ 120Hz
Applications: General Purpose
Ratings: --
Series: URS
Operating Temperature: -40°C ~ 85°C
Lifetime @ Temp.: 2000 Hrs @ 85°C
ESR (Equivalent Series Resistance): --
Voltage - Rated: 16V
Tolerance: ±20%
Capacitance: 1000µF
Moisture Sensitivity Level (MSL): --
Part Status: Active
Lead Free Status / RoHS Status: --
Packaging: Bulk
